Steps to writing a descriptive essay
When you write a descriptive essay, it is better if you have a plan of writing. I mean that a student preparing a paper should plan all his or her actions beforehand. It is very useful, especially for those students who are really busy and do not feel like wasting their time. Though composing of a plan takes some time, you will save much more time after, when you set to work, because you will not have to think about what to do next and how to make it better. A plan will direct your work, saving your time.
We offer you a plan of a descriptive essay writing. It consists of several steps, and you can pass to the following step only after completing the previous on. Otherwise you will get into a mess mix, and you will have no choice but to start from the narrow beginning.
Choose a descriptive essay topic.
Make sure that you have knowledge enough to compose a descriptive essay on a chosen topic. If you discover a lack of knowledge, you had better fulfilled the stack at once.
Think over the topic development within your descriptive essay, and compose its outline. The outline should be full of details if you do not want to forget or to miss something important.
Write a descriptive essay as it was planned. Do it slowly, do not start writing the next part if you have not finished the previous one. Remember that you have to write essay according to the outlined order. It is not acceptable to compose separate parts and combine them after completing all of them.
Revise your descriptive essay for mistakes. Correct all the mistakes you will find, and repeat a revision once more to make sure that your paper contains no more mistakes.
